The angel's little sister ('she can do anything!') isn't content with being God's chief harpist: sweet and virtuous.. Oh no! Drum kit and hell are for her! Off she goes. to her brother's despair, falls in love with a two -timing snake, and in furious revenge plans to blow up the universe, snake with it.

Can the little angel get there in time to stop her?

(the third story in Finnegan's stunning 'Angel Quartet' series).

Ruth Finnegan is a visiting research professor and emeritus professor in the faculty of social sciences at the Open University in the U.K. Finnegan's work Finnegan's work touches on controversial issues about the nature of popular culture, the anthropology and sociology of music, and the quality of people's pathways in modern urban life. Her books include, The Hidden Musicians: Music-Making in an English Town, Communicating: The Multiple Modes of Human Interconnection, Tales of the City: A Study of Narrative and Urban Life, South Pacific Oral Traditions (edited with Margaret Orbell); and Oral Poetry: Its Nature, Significance, and Social Context.

    "If thou must love me, let it be for nought

    Except for love’s sake only. Do not say

    ‘I love her for her smile – her look – her way

    Of speaking gently, - for a trick of thought

    That falls in well with mine, and certes brought

    A sense of pleasant ease on such a day’ –

    For these things in themselves Beloved, may

    Be changed or change for thee, - and love so wrought

    May be unwrought so. Neither love me for

    Thine own dear pity’s wiping my cheeks dry.

    A creature might forget to weep, who bore

    Their comfort long and lose thy love thereby!

    But love me for love’s sake, that evermore

    Thou must love on, through love’s eternity."

    Elizabeth Barrett Browning

    Sonnets from the Portuguese
